Enhanced Emergency Response
In emergencies, integrated systems can react more swiftly than manual processes. For instance, when a fire is detected, the fire alarm can signal the security system to unlock specific doors, facilitating quicker access to emergency exits. Conversely, if a security breach occurs in a fire exit route, security personnel can intervene promptly to ensure the exit remains accessible, particularly in high-stakes environments like airports and detention facilities.
Streamlined Monitoring and Control
Combining fire safety and security systems into a single platform allows building managers and security personnel to oversee operations from one central location. This centralization simplifies management and ensures that safety and security measures function in harmony. When an alarm is triggered, the system can quickly identify the fire’s location and highlight security concerns, such as blocked exits or unauthorized individuals in restricted areas. Integrating CCTV with fire safety systems enhances situational awareness, allowing security teams to monitor not only security events but also the progression of a fire in real-time. This visual data is invaluable for directing emergency response teams and conducting post-incident analyses.
Safe and Efficient Emergency Evacuation
Access-controlled doors must align with security goals as part of fire safety strategies. This alignment is particularly critical in facilities like data centers, hospitals, and correctional institutions, where certain areas must remain secure even during a fire. Proper integration ensures that fire safety measures do not conflict with security protocols, allowing for safe and efficient evacuations.

Integration with Building Automation Systems (BAS)
Integrating fire safety strategies with Building Automation Systems enhances the safety of modern structures. BAS controls various utilities, including lighting and HVAC, and plays a critical role during emergencies. For example, it can automatically shut down HVAC systems to prevent smoke spread and adjust lighting to guide occupants safely to evacuation routes. Additionally, BAS provides real-time information to building managers, enabling quick and informed decision-making during crises.
The Evolving Relationship between Fire Safety and Security
The built environment across the MENA region is entering a new era characterized by connectivity, intelligence, and resilience. The traditional divide between fire and life safety systems and security frameworks is diminishing, paving the way for a unified ecosystem focused on safeguarding people, assets, and operational continuity.
Historically, fire engineers and security consultants operated in separate domains, with fire safety focusing on detection, alarm activation, and evacuation, while security concentrated on surveillance and access control. However, as urban areas become smarter and buildings more interconnected, these systems must collaborate rather than function in isolation. The next generation of safe buildings will depend on seamless data flow and cooperation between fire safety and security disciplines.

The Future of Intelligent Integration
Future buildings will not merely react to incidents; they will predict and adapt to them. When fire safety and security systems communicate effectively, they transform structures into responsive entities capable of making informed decisions in real time. For instance, a smoke detector can trigger a fire alarm while simultaneously unlocking access-controlled doors to facilitate evacuations. CCTV systems can automatically focus on affected areas, providing operators with immediate visual confirmation. Voice evacuation and mass notification systems can deliver multilingual instructions tailored to specific incidents, while Building Management Systems (BMS) unify responses across fire, security, and HVAC systems.
